#57B33D Color
#57B33D is rgb(87, 179, 61) in RGB, hsl(107, 49%, 47%) in HSL, and about cmyk(51%, 0%, 66%, 30%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Green (RYB) (#66B032),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.58.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#57B33D Channel Values
How #57B33D bre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 87 · G 179 · B 61 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 107° · S 49% · L 47%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 107° · S 66% · V 70%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 51% · M 0% · Y 66% · K 30%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.65:1 vs white · 7.92: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#57B33D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#57B33D?
#57B33D is a mid-tone green — rgb(87, 179, 61) in RGB and hsl(107, 49%, 47%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Green (RYB) (#66B032),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.58.
What is the RGB value of #57B33D?
#57B33D is rgb(87, 179, 61) — red 87, green 179, and blue 61 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#57B33D?
#57B33D converts to approximately cmyk(51%, 0%, 66%, 30%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#57B33D be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#57B33D scores 2.65:1 against white and 7.92: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#57B33D as a CSS color keyword?
No. #57B33D is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is forestgreen (#228B22) at a CIE76 distance of 15.81, which is visibly different.
